LINK 2.0 Underway for Animas SeniorsA small group of Animas seniors began LINK 2.0 on the week of September 25th in order to continue spreading their wings in the community and to gain even more real-world work experience as part of their post-secondary preparation process.
LINK 2.0 is an opportunity for Animas seniors to work in the community as interns under the mentorship of a community member to deepen their professional experience. “LINK 2.0 is for students who want more of what they did in junior year, or for students who want to try a completely different career on for size,” says Janae Hunderman, the LINK Coordinator at Animas High School. While Hunderman is putting most of her effort into preparing juniors for LINK 1.0 in the spring, she also supports seniors to have this additional experience, however, she more hands-off. The seniors are required to intern 60 hours, but the time can be spread throughout the semester. Seniors are still required to produce a project, and at the end of their internship, they will meet with Janae and their mentor to present on how the experience impacted their growth and their future career plans. Eight students have decided to participate in LINK 2.0 this first semester, approximately 13.3% of the senior class. Collectively, they are exploring the fields of marketing, business, filmmaking, journalism, engineering, health care, and psychology. |
